Description: This series consists of 12 documents pertaining to the honorable discharge of Maurice Goldstein, Second Lieutenant. Documents include a laminated wallet copy of Goldstein’s discharge certificate, his separation qualification record, application for allowance readjustment, reserve officer application, classification card, official copies of his discharge certificate dated 1946 and 1947, and a 1947 certificate recognizing his promotion in 1942.;Military documentation, discharge papers, and the personnel file from the service of Second Lieutenant Maurice Goldstein, who served as a Motor Transport Officer in the 159th Infantry Regiment, 106th Infantry Division in the European Theater of Operations. The collection is arranged into three series: I. Enlistment and service documents, 1940-1944; II. Discharge papers; and III. Personnel file, 1941-1946.
